#include "FreeImage.h"
#include "Utilities.h"
// ----------------------------------------------------------
// Constants + headers
// ----------------------------------------------------------
#ifdef _WIN32
#pragma pack(push, 1)
#else
#pragma pack(1)
#endif
typedef struct tagTGAHEADER {
BYTE id_length; //! length of the image ID field
BYTE color_map_type; //! whether a color map is included
BYTE image_type; //! compression and color types
WORD cm_first_entry; //! first entry index (offset into the color map table)
WORD cm_length; //! color map length (number of entries)
BYTE cm_size; //! color map entry size, in bits (number of bits per pixel)
WORD is_xorigin; //! X-origin of image (absolute coordinate of lower-left corner for displays where origin is at the lower left)
WORD is_yorigin; //! Y-origin of image (as for X-origin)
WORD is_width; //! image width
WORD is_height; //! image height
BYTE is_pixel_depth; //! bits per pixel
BYTE is_image_descriptor; //! image descriptor, bits 3-0 give the alpha channel depth, bits 5-4 give direction
} TGAHEADER;
typedef struct tagTGAEXTENSIONAREA {
WORD extension_size; // Size in bytes of the extension area, always 495
char author_name[41]; // Name of the author. If not used, bytes should be set to NULL (\0) or spaces
char author_comments[324]; // A comment, organized as four lines, each consisting of 80 characters plus a NULL
WORD datetime_stamp[6]; // Date and time at which the image was created
char job_name[41]; // Job ID
WORD job_time[3]; // Hours, minutes and seconds spent creating the file (for billing, etc.)
char software_id[41]; // The application that created the file
BYTE software_version[3];
DWORD key_color;
WORD pixel_aspect_ratio[2];
WORD gamma_value[2];
DWORD color_correction_offset; // Number of bytes from the beginning of the file to the color correction table if present
DWORD postage_stamp_offset; // Number of bytes from the beginning of the file to the postage stamp image if present
DWORD scan_line_offset; // Number of bytes from the beginning of the file to the scan lines table if present
BYTE attributes_type; // Specifies the alpha channel
} TGAEXTENSIONAREA;
typedef struct tagTGAFOOTER {
DWORD extension_offset; // extension area offset : offset in bytes from the beginning of the file
DWORD developer_offset; // developer directory offset : offset in bytes from the beginning of the file
char signature[18]; // signature string : contains "TRUEVISION-XFILE.\0"
} TGAFOOTER;
#ifdef _WIN32
#pragma pack(pop)
#else
#pragma pack()
#endif
static const char *FI_MSG_ERROR_CORRUPTED = "Image data corrupted";
// ----------------------------------------------------------
// Image type
//
#define TGA_NULL 0 // no image data included
#define TGA_CMAP 1 // uncompressed, color-mapped image
#define TGA_RGB 2 // uncompressed, true-color image
#define TGA_MONO 3 // uncompressed, black-and-white image
#define TGA_RLECMAP 9 // run-length encoded, color-mapped image
#define TGA_RLERGB 10 // run-length encoded, true-color image
#define TGA_RLEMONO 11 // run-length encoded, black-and-white image
#define TGA_CMPCMAP 32 // compressed (Huffman/Delta/RLE) color-mapped image (e.g., VDA/D) - Obsolete
#define TGA_CMPCMAP4 33 // compressed (Huffman/Delta/RLE) color-mapped four pass image (e.g., VDA/D) - Obsolete

// ==========================================================
// Internal functions
// ==========================================================
/** This class is used when loading RLE compressed images, it implements io cache of fixed size.
In general RLE compressed images *should* be compressed line by line with line sizes stored in Scan Line Table section.
In reality, however there are images not obeying the specification, compressing image data continuously across lines,
making it impossible to load the file cached at every line.
*/
class IOCache
{
public:
IOCache(FreeImageIO *io, fi_handle handle, size_t size) :
_ptr(NULL), _begin(NULL), _end(NULL), _size(size), _io(io), _handle(handle) {
_begin = (BYTE*)malloc(size);
if (_begin) {
_end = _begin + _size;
_ptr = _end; // will force refill on first access
}
}
~IOCache() {
if (_begin != NULL) {
free(_begin);
}
}
BOOL isNull() { return _begin == NULL;}
inline
BYTE getByte() {
if (_ptr >= _end) {
// need refill
_ptr = _begin;
_io->read_proc(_ptr, sizeof(BYTE), (unsigned)_size, _handle); //### EOF - no problem?
}
BYTE result = *_ptr;
_ptr++;
return result;
}
inline
BYTE* getBytes(size_t count /*must be < _size!*/) {
if (_ptr + count >= _end) {
// need refill
// 'count' bytes might span two cache bounds,
// SEEK back to add the remains of the current cache again into the new one
long read = long(_ptr - _begin);
long remaining = long(_size - read);
_io->seek_proc(_handle, -remaining, SEEK_CUR);
_ptr = _begin;
_io->read_proc(_ptr, sizeof(BYTE), (unsigned)_size, _handle); //### EOF - no problem?
}
BYTE *result = _ptr;
_ptr += count;
return result;
}
private:
IOCache& operator=(const IOCache& src); // deleted
IOCache(const IOCache& other); // deleted
private:
BYTE *_ptr;
BYTE *_begin;
BYTE *_end;
const size_t _size;
const FreeImageIO *_io;
const fi_handle _handle;
};

static void
saveRLE(FIBITMAP* dib, FreeImageIO* io, fi_handle handle) {
// Image is compressed line by line, packets don't span multiple lines (TGA2.0 recommendation)
const unsigned width = FreeImage_GetWidth(dib);
const unsigned height = FreeImage_GetHeight(dib);
const unsigned pixel_size = FreeImage_GetBPP(dib)/8;
const unsigned line_size = FreeImage_GetLine(dib);
const BYTE max_packet_size = 128;
BYTE packet_count = 0;
BOOL has_rle = FALSE;
// packet (compressed or not) to be written to line
BYTE* const packet_begin = (BYTE*)malloc(max_packet_size * pixel_size);
BYTE* packet = packet_begin;
// line to be written to disk
// Note: we need some extra bytes for anti-commpressed lines. The worst case is:
// 8 bit images were every 3th pixel is different.
// Rle packet becomes two pixels, but nothing is compressed: two byte pixels are transformed into byte header and byte pixel value
// After every rle packet there is a non-rle packet of one pixel: an extra byte for the header will be added for it
// In the end we gain no bytes from compression, but also must insert a byte at every 3th pixel
// add extra space for anti-commpressed lines
size_t extra_space = (size_t)ceil(width / 3.0);
BYTE* const line_begin = (BYTE*)malloc(width * pixel_size + extra_space);
BYTE* line = line_begin;
BYTE *current = (BYTE*)malloc(pixel_size);
BYTE *next = (BYTE*)malloc(pixel_size);
for(unsigned y = 0; y < height; y++) {
BYTE *bits = FreeImage_GetScanLine(dib, y);
// rewind line pointer
line = line_begin;
for(unsigned x = 0; x < line_size; x += pixel_size) {
AssignPixel(current, (bits + x), pixel_size);
// read next pixel from dib
if( x + 1*pixel_size < line_size) {
AssignPixel(next, (bits + x + 1*pixel_size), pixel_size);
} else {
// last pixel in line
// include current pixel and flush
if(!has_rle) {
writeToPacket(packet, current, pixel_size);
packet += pixel_size;
}
assert(packet_count < max_packet_size);
++packet_count;
flushPacket(line, pixel_size, packet_begin, packet, packet_count, has_rle);
// start anew on next line
break;
}
if(isEqualPixel(current, next, pixel_size)) {
// has rle
if(!has_rle) {
// flush non rle packet
flushPacket(line, pixel_size, packet_begin, packet, packet_count, has_rle);
// start a rle packet
has_rle = TRUE;
writeToPacket(packet, current, pixel_size);
packet += pixel_size;
}
// otherwise do nothing. We will just increase the count at the end
} else {
// no rle
if(has_rle) {
// flush rle packet
// include current pixel first
assert(packet_count < max_packet_size);
++packet_count;
flushPacket(line, pixel_size, packet_begin, packet, packet_count, has_rle);
// start anew on the next pixel
continue;
} else {
writeToPacket(packet, current, pixel_size);
packet += pixel_size;
}
}
// increase counter on every pixel
++packet_count;
if(packet_count == max_packet_size) {
flushPacket(line, pixel_size, packet_begin, packet, packet_count, has_rle);
}
}//for width
// write line to disk
io->write_proc(line_begin, 1, (unsigned)(line - line_begin), handle);
}//for height
free(line_begin);
free(packet_begin);
free(current);
free(next);
}
